ZetaIII with Bride FX rails, wanted FIA cert rails since the seats were also FIA cert. There is no movement of the seats with this rail, must find your seating postion, bolt it in and set for you. Plus it is much lighter than Bride's other rails. Had FO type rails in my old Teggy and they weigh a ton compared.
